Written preview for episode 16:

Even though Samantha can see that Xiao Ru is 100% committed to Jie Xiu, but she can also see how much Daniel is fixated on Xiao Ru. Knowing how childish and self-absorbed Jie Xiu can be at times, Samantha doesn’t have faith in his ability to succeed in this complicated love battle. Being the Queen of Ideas, Samantha takes advantage of QQ’s return to Taiwan. Mother and son collaborate and stage a “Trojan Horse to Force a Wedding” plot. It’s touching to see that all of Xiao Ru’s co-workers are on Samantha’s side and await her instructions.

Of course Samantha’s Trojan Horse plot succeeds and Xiao Ru and Jie Xiu successfully complete both an engagement party and celebrate her promotion. Just as Jie Xiu is relieved that he has nothing to worry about and his happiness is right at his fingertips, suddenly Samantha takes a tumble down the stairs. All evidence points to Xiao Ru as the culprit who caused Samantha’s fall!

After emergency surgery, the doctor conveys a dire prognosis. Xiao Ru feels immense guilt while Jie Xiu holds his worry inside and tries to comfort Xiao Ru. The two of them can only wait and continue to be each other’s support. At this time, Daniel refuses to be an interloper and take advantage of the situation. He elects to be Xiao Ru’s white knight and just keep watch over her from a distance.

Xiao Ru doesn’t realize that Jie Xiu’s strength in front of her is just an act, and that he’s truly conflicted and in pain. Just when Xiao Ru is unable to accept this cruel truth, she runs into the famous bread maker Wu Bao Chun, who’s bread gave her immense comfort and inspiration when she was a child. She has a new understanding after hearing his encouragement, leading her to take Daniel’s advice. For Jie Xiu’s sake, Xiao Ru makes a decision…….
